The Potential Downsides of the Costume Craziness:

  • The Pressure to Be Perfect: Social media is both a blessing and a curse. While it showcases incredible talent, it also puts pressure on people to compete, to have the most elaborate, the most perfectly executed costume. It can be exhausting.
  • Cost (Literally): Let’s be real, costumes can be expensive. Sewing machines, fabric, wigs, props – the costs add up. It can be a barrier for some people who can't afford the hobby.
  • The "Copycat" Problem: The popularity of certain characters can lead to… well, a lot of similar costumes. It can be disheartening if you put your heart and soul into a unique costume only to see a hundred other versions.
  • The Risk of Being Misunderstood: Some costumes can be misinterpreted, seen as insensitive, or just plain weird. It’s important to be aware of the potential impact of your choices and, you know, maybe read the room!

The Hidden Gems: Leveraging Recent Pop Culture Costumes for Maximum Impact

So, you've got your inspiration. Now what? It's about more than just what you choose. It's about how you execute.

  • Research is your BFF: Don't just assume you know what a character looks like. Google images, watch trailers, read reviews! The deeper you dive, the more authentic your costume will be. And let's be honest, the more impressive!

  • DIY or Buy? The Great Debate: Here's the deal: sometimes, buying is the way to go. Sometimes, DIY is the ultimate expression of love. Consider your skills, your budget, and your time. If you're short on time, don't be afraid to buy a base costume and then add your own personal touches. It's all about creating something you love. Me? I love a good DIY, even if it's a bit of a mess.

  • Accessorize, Accessorize, Accessorize: This is key. The right accessories can make or break any costume. Think about props, makeup, wigs, and even your demeanor. A grumpy Wednesday Addams needs the right frown!

  • Embrace the Imperfection!: So, you're not a professional seamstress? That's fine! A little imperfection can make a costume even more charming. It shows you put in the effort – and that you're not afraid to have fun!
